Always Look for a Clearance Section

No matter how good a vape shop’s regular prices might be, there’s a good chance that they’ll still have a clearance section where the prices are even lower. Vapes can be sold on clearance for a variety of different reasons, and most of those reasons have nothing to do with the quality of the experience you’ll have with those devices. Suppose, for example, that the manufacturer starts using a new box design or changes the name of a flavor. In that case, the previous version needs to be cleared out to make room for the new version.

You may occasionally find vapes that are being offered at clearance prices because they’re close to expiring. The e-liquid may begin to degrade slightly in a vape that’s more than a year old, resulting in slightly lower flavor quality and reduced nicotine content. The price may be so low that you won’t be bothered by buying an older vape. If you’re concerned about the age of the product, you should contact the vape shop before buying it. Be warned, though, that a cheap disposable vape won’t remain available for long either way if the price is low enough.

Make Sure You’re Buying Authentic

When you shop for cheap disposable vapes, one of the most important things to remember is that you’re much more likely to find counterfeit devices when they’re being offered at prices that seem too good to be true. Fake vapes are manufactured by the millions, and they often look almost indistinguishable from authentic products. Here’s how to ensure that you won’t have to worry about getting fake vapes.

  • Buy only from specialist vape shops. Vape shops should always get their devices from the original manufacturers or from distributors who work directly with the manufacturers. Convenience stores and gas stations, on the other hand, could source their vapes from almost anywhere.
  • Before you open a new vape, look for the authenticity code on the box. Go to the manufacturer’s website and type the code to confirm that the device is authentic. Type the website’s URL manually or search for it on Google. Don’t use the QR code because fake vapes sometimes have fake QR codes on their boxes.
  • Even if the authenticity code passes the check, you should still take a look at the box for any obvious quality control issues before opening and using the vape. If the box has blurry text, washed-out colors or poor-quality cardstock, those are all potential signs of a fake vape. The packaging for an authentic vape should always look very professional.
  • After removing the vape from the package, check for any fit and finish issues on the device itself. Seams should be almost invisible. Plastic injection molding points should be smooth and not sharp. You shouldn’t be able to scrape text and graphics off with your fingernail. Colors should match. If the device looks less than professional, you should treat it is a potential fake and avoid using it.
  • Even if everything about a vape looks completely correct, you should still pay close attention to the way it tastes and the way you feel when you use it. Fake vapes will never taste the same as real devices because the factories manufacturing the counterfeit products don’t have access to the same e-liquids that the real brands use. If anything doesn’t taste or feel right, you should avoid using the device.
